Industry Trends: The Shift to Remote Sensing & AI

FTIR Telemetry

Fourier Transform Infrared (FTIR) technology is revolutionizing remote monitoring, allowing for the identification of multiple gas components from miles away without direct contact.

IMS Technology

Ion Mobility Spectrometry (IMS) provides handheld, rapid response identification of chemical threats, essential for first responders and border security.

IoT Integration

Real-time data transmission to cloud platforms enables centralized command centers to monitor entire industrial parks from a single dashboard.

The integration of Artificial Intelligence (AI) into toxic agent monitoring systems has significantly reduced false alarm rates. Modern algorithms can now distinguish between benign background gases and actual hazardous threats in complex urban or industrial environments.
